Summary
"Ecocriticism and Geocriticism: Overlapping Territories in Environmental and Spatial Literary Studies presents an interdisciplinary collection of essays which address the complementary and contested aspects of these related, but sometimes conflicting, approaches to literature, cultural, and society in the twenty-first century"--

Contents
Ecocritical Geographies, Geocritical Ecologies, and the Spaces of Modernity / Robert T. Tally Jr. and Christine M. Battista -- Geocriticism Meets Ecocriticism: Bertrand Westphal and Environmental Thinking / Eric Prieto -- Ecocritical and Geocritical Conjunctions in North Atlantic Environmental Multimedia and Place-Based Poetry / Derek Gladwin -- Noncommittal Commitment: Alien Spaces of Ecocosmopolitics in Recent World Literature / Ted Geier -- Affective Edgelands: Wildness, History, and Technology in Britain's Postindustrial and Postnatural Topographies / Tom Bristow -- 'The sea was the river, the river the sea': The Severn Estuary and the Bristol Channel in Robert Minhinnick and Philip Gross / Louise Chamberlain -- Black Jungle, Beautiful Forest: A Postcolonial, Green Geocriticism of the Indian Sundarbans; Luca Raimondi -- Outside Within: Natural Environment and Social Place in Daphne du Maurier's Rebecca / Stanka Radović -- Joseph Hall's Mundus Alter et Idem and the Geosatirical Indictment of the English Crown / Dan Mills -- Nature and the Oppressed Female Body in Nora Okja Keller's Ecofeminist Aesthetics / Silvia Schultermandl -- Toward an Environmental Imagination of Displacement in Contemporary Transnational American Poetry / Judith Rauscher.
